Due to a manufacturing defect, certain Omnipod 5 Pods from 49 lots have an internal soft cannula tear that results in insulin leaking into the Pod instead of being delivered to the user regardless of basal or bolus delivery. This defect results from damage to the unexposed portion of the soft cannula during manufacturing, which would result in a compromised fluid path. The primary failure mode is pump under-delivery due to loss of insulin to an internal leak; in some cases, the defect may also lead to pump shutoff and cessation of insulin delivery when leaked insulin contacts Pod circuity in a manner that results in an electrical short. Under-delivery of insulin (both basal and bolus insulin) or cessation of insulin put users at risk of hyperglycemia, and complications from acute and chronic hyperglycemia, including dehydration, blurry vision, nausea, vomiting, altered mental status, diabetic ketoacidosis (DKA), hyperglycemic hyperosmolar syndrome (HHS), or even death. Users may require hospitalization or medical intervention to treat severe adverse health consequences. Not all devices with the defect will issue an alarm or alert the user. If there is sufficient leakage of insulin to cause a short in the circuity, the Pod will issue a Hazard Alarm that stops all insulin delivery and alerts the user to replace their Pod. In addition, if a user s glucose is trending high and is not responding to insulin delivery, the system may reach the maximum amount of insulin microboluses allowed by the system and trigger the Automated Delivery Restriction (ADR) alert that tells users to check their blood glucose and take appropriate actions (i.e., ADR is a response to persistent hyperglycemia and maximum automated delivery constraints rather than a direct detection of the leak). The magnitude of under-delivery is unknown and based on multiple factors, including how much insulin is being delivered, whether an alarm and/or alert triggers, whether and when the user recognizes the device defect, the duration of Pod use, and the size of the tear.

Potential safety issue involving the Mean Aneurysm Flow Amplitude (MAFA) ratio of AneurysmFlow (Interventional Tool). Philips has determined that the MAFA ratio does not provide reliable prognostic information regarding aneurysm occlusion following Flow Diverter Stent treatment, however despite being stated in the IUF, it is being relied on for making clinical decisions.
it was found that in versions 1.3.7, 1.4.2, and 1.4.3, the Lock Screen and Limited Access Passcode Screen on the iLet graphical user interface (GUI) include certain icons displayed in the status bar that are active, thereby allowing the user to bypass those screens when those icons on the status bar are pressed, allowing unauthorized access while the device is in Limited Access Mode. A Health Risk associated with Limited access mode includes severe hypoglycemia due to unauthorized access to the iLet if someone were to make unauthorized meal announcements or stopped insulin delivery.

Siemens Medical Solutions USA
During 3D acquisitions, lighter and darker patient images may be captured, which may result in less accurate 3D reconstruction. The variation of brightness is a result of a constant unregulated medium dose and the angular change of patient diameter caused by rotational acquisition. This may result in unintentional low-dose radiation exposure to a patient.
